Wood you believe that!
On one glorious day, the fair maidens decided to go for a carriage ride. They traveled up and down the myriad of roadways in search of something new. As they were passing by a lovely park, a memory stirred in Sarah's psyche. "Wait!" she cried, "I remember that place! My grandparents used to take me there as a child. Can't we please stop for a moment?" Shannon immediately slowed the carriage looking for a place to turn. Her rule had always been never to turn back, but she also wanted to she this place that stirred such a response from her truest friend. Around a bend there was a drive, so Shannon swung the carriage around and started to back in when "THUMP!"
"Uh-oh" Shannon moaned. "What was that?" As she tried to pull the carriage forward, Shannon realized they were stuck on something! So they leaped out of the carriage to find out what was going on. Lo and behold, they were on a log! "Hmmm." pondered Shannon. "Let's try rocking the carriage back and forth." So she climbed back in and tried to go back and forth, but to no avail.
"What if I bounced on it while you tried that?" suggested Sarah. But again, they reached no results. They lifted and pried, and jumped and revved, but nothing was helping. They even tried getting help from a nearby cottage, but alas, no one was home. As the lasses stood pondering what to do, a young man happened around the corner. He must have realized the maidens were in a bind, for he offered his services. Sarah and Shannon quickly accepted, not knowing what else to do. So the man came behind their carriage and while Shannon tried to go forward, he pushed with all his might, and "ZOOM!" The carriage was free once again! Sarah and Shannon cheered and thanked the man with heartfelt appreciation, but the man would accept nothing from the women in payment, and disappeared into the horizon.
